Transformative Shifts in the Landscape
The mild alkaline cleaning agent landscape is undergoing transformative shifts as companies reinterpret performance metrics, regulatory compliance, and sustainability benchmarks. Formulation scientists are increasingly leveraging advanced chelating agents and enzyme blends to enhance soil removal efficiency while minimizing environmental footprints. This pivot toward green chemistry has prompted a wave of product relaunches featuring plant-based surfactants, reduced pH levels, and fully biodegradable components.
Digitalization is further reshaping operational paradigms. Smart dosing technologies, IoT-enabled dispensing systems, and predictive maintenance platforms are enabling real-time monitoring of chemical usage, water consumption, and equipment health. Organizations that adopt these tools can optimize resource allocation, reduce wastewater volumes, and demonstrate compliance with tightening discharge regulations.
Meanwhile, market entry barriers are evolving. Legacy players must revamp supply chains to source sustainable raw materials, while agile newcomers are seizing market share by offering niche, eco-certified solutions. Private-label manufacturers are forging strategic alliances with specialty chemical producers to expedite time-to-market. As a result, industry stakeholders face a dual imperative: innovate formulation science to meet stringent performance standards and embrace digital capabilities to strengthen operational resilience.
Cumulative Impact of United States Tariffs 2025
The introduction of new United States tariff measures in 2025 has accelerated strategic realignments across the mild alkaline chemical cleaning agent value chain. Import duties on key raw materials and intermediates, particularly those sourced from select commodity-exporting regions, have increased landed costs by up to 12%. Manufacturers reliant on international supply networks have faced margin compression, prompting a reevaluation of procurement strategies.
In response, several producers have regionalized operations, investing in domestic production facilities and securing long-term contracts with local feedstock suppliers. This localization trend has mitigated exposure to tariff volatility and alleviated lead-time pressures. Meanwhile, importers have diversified sourcing to alternative low-tariff jurisdictions, albeit at the expense of longer transit times and added logistics complexity.
Despite short-term disruptions, the tariff environment has spurred long-term efficiencies. Companies are consolidating shipments, optimizing container utilization, and adopting just-in-time inventory models to curb carrying costs. Collaborative initiatives between chemical suppliers and end users are emerging, focusing on bulk procurement and strategic stockpiling to lock in favorable pricing. As market participants navigate these headwinds, the cumulative impact of tariff dynamics is catalyzing operational resilience and supply chain agility.
Key Segmentation Insights
A nuanced understanding of market segmentation reveals that mild alkaline cleaning agents cater to multifaceted needs spanning applications, end-use industries, product types, distribution channels, and user demographics. Across applications in commercial environments such as office buildings, public facilities, and shopping complexes, the preference is shifting toward high-efficiency formulations that minimize downtime and labor costs. In domestic settings, bathroom, floor and carpet, and kitchen cleaners now emphasize non-toxic residues and hypoallergenic profiles to satisfy consumer safety concerns. Industrial contexts-encompassing floor cleaning, machinery maintenance, and surface decontamination-require robust formulations capable of withstanding high-temperature and heavy-soiling conditions.
By end-use, the food and beverage sector, including breweries, dairy industries, and processing plants, demands strict compliance with sanitary regulations, driving the adoption of mild alkaline agents that ensure product purity. Healthcare environments such as hospitals, in-patient care centers, and laboratories prioritize antimicrobial efficacy without compromising surface integrity. The manufacturing domain-spanning automotive, metal fabrication, and textile production-values cleaners that remove oils, greases, and particulate matter efficiently, safeguarding equipment longevity.
Product-type differentiation underscores the market’s breadth: gel cleaners designed for multi-surface applications and tough stain removal, liquid concentrates and ready-to-use solutions for streamlined operations, and powder formulations available in bulk or individual packs to accommodate diverse usage frequencies. Distribution channels range from direct B2B and institutional sales to online platforms and e-commerce sites, as well as specialty stores and supermarkets that cater to professional and DIY markets. Finally, user demographics such as homeowners and small business owners require straightforward solutions, while facility managers in corporate offices and educational institutions seek centralized dosing systems. Professional cleaning agencies and industrial service providers demand high-performance chemistries that integrate seamlessly into automated cleaning regimens.

Key Regional Insights
Regional dynamics exert a profound influence on the mild alkaline cleaning agent market, with varying regulatory, economic, and cultural factors shaping demand profiles. In the Americas, growth is fueled by stringent hygiene standards in food processing and a rising emphasis on sustainable manufacturing, prompting investments in biodegradable and low-toxicity formulations. The region’s robust distribution infrastructure facilitates rapid product rollouts, while R&D hubs in North America accelerate innovation in chelating technologies.
Europe, the Middle East & Africa (EMEA) represent a diverse regulatory tapestry where REACH compliance, eco-label certifications, and circular economy mandates drive market adoption. Western European nations lead in green chemistry initiatives, whereas emerging markets in the Middle East and Africa are witnessing increased industrial activity and infrastructural expansion, boosting demand for heavy-duty alkaline cleaners. Cross-border trade agreements and regional free-trade zones further influence cost dynamics and sourcing decisions.
In the Asia-Pacific, rapid urbanization, expanding healthcare networks, and a burgeoning hospitality sector underpin market growth. Countries in the region prioritize localized formulations that address water quality variations and cultural preferences, such as fragrance intensity and pH sensitivity. Investments in manufacturing capabilities, coupled with government incentives for export-oriented chemical producers, position Asia-Pacific as a strategic hotbed for both volume production and innovation.

Key Company Insights
The competitive landscape of mild alkaline cleaning agents is characterized by a blend of global giants and specialized players, each leveraging distinct strengths to capture market share. 3M Company’s prowess in research and development has yielded proprietary surfactants that deliver enhanced cleaning power with lower environmental impact. AkzoNobel N.V. continues to expand its eco-certified portfolio, incorporating renewable feedstocks into its formulations. Ashland Global Holdings Inc. focuses on custom solutions for industrial clients, providing turnkey services that include formulation advisory and on-site support.
BASF SE and Clariant AG are driving advances in chelating chemistry, enabling more efficient soil emulsification at reduced dosages. Eastman Chemical Company harnesses its polymer expertise to produce advanced rheology modifiers, improving product stability and user experience. Ecolab Inc. distinguishes itself with integrated service models, pairing high-performance cleaning agents with digital monitoring platforms to optimize dosing.
Evonik Industries AG’s specialty additives enhance cleaning kinetics, while Henkel AG & Co. KGaA leverages its strong consumer brands to penetrate retail markets. Huntsman Corporation and Kao Corporation are notable for their investments in bio-based surfactants. PPG Industries, Inc. channels its coatings expertise toward protective cleaning solutions. S. C. Johnson & Son, Inc. remains a household name through its trusted consumer lines. Solvay S.A. and The Dow Chemical Company maintain broad portfolios that span industrial and institutional segments, underpinned by global manufacturing networks and collaborative innovation consortia.
